- var lazyIterators = require("../lib/lazy-iterators");
- exports.convertingArrayToIteratorAndBack = function(test) {
- var original = ["apple", "banana", "coconut"];
- var iterator = lazyIterators.fromArray(original);
- var reconstituted = iterator.toArray();
- test.deepEqual(original, reconstituted);
- test.done();
- };
- exports.mapAppliesFunctionToEveryElement = function(test) {
- var original = [1, 2, 3];
- var squared = lazyIterators.fromArray(original).map(function(i) {
- return i * i;
- }).toArray();
- test.deepEqual([1, 4, 9], squared);
- test.done();
- };
- exports.mappingFunctionIsOnlyCalledWhenNecessary = function(test) {
- var original = [1, 2, 3];
- var faultySquared = lazyIterators.fromArray(original).map(function(i) {
- if (i === 1) {
- return i;
- } else {
- throw new Error("Can only calculate the square of one");
- }
- }).first();
- test.deepEqual(1, faultySquared);
- test.done();
- };
- exports.filterRetainsElementsThatSatisfyPredicate = function(test) {
- var original = [1, 2, 3, 4];
- var even = lazyIterators.fromArray(original).filter(function(i) {
- return i % 2 === 0;
- }).toArray();
- test.deepEqual([2, 4], even);
- test.done();
- };
- exports.firstReturnsFirstElementOfArray = function(test) {
- var original = [1, 2, 3, 4];
- var first = lazyIterators.fromArray(original).first();
- test.deepEqual(1, first);
- test.done();
- };
- exports.firstIsNullIfArrayIsEmpty = function(test) {
- var first = lazyIterators.fromArray([]).first();
- test.same(null, first);
- test.done();
- };
